Universal Certificate

Utah uses one universal certificate for legalized documents, regardless of whether the destination country is a member of the 1961 Hague Apostille Convention. This single certificate is valid in all countries.

You can verify any Utah authentication using our Online Verification Portal.

How the Universal Certificate Works

  • For Hague Member Countries: It serves as an Apostille, verifying the origin of a public document for use in member countries.
  • For Non-Hague Member Countries: It functions identically as a standard Certificate of Authentication.

The unaltered, legalized document must be accepted by any receiving country. A properly issued Certificate may only be rejected if the legalized document itself has been embellished, modified, or otherwise tampered with.

Fees & Processing Times

  • Processing Time Notice
    Our typical processing times apply only to our portion of the request. When a third party is involved for authentication, the overall processing time may be extended, as we cannot account for their schedule.

  • Regular Service

    $19.00 / document

    • 3 to 5 business days in-office processing time.
    • Does not include mailing transit time.

    Next Day Service

    $53.00 / document

    • Ready for pick-up the following business day.
    • Does not include mailing transit time.

    Same Day Service

    $93.00 / document

    • Can take up to 2 hours to process (depends on quantity/availability).
    • Mail Warning: If mailed to us, we may not mail it back the same day unless you include a prepaid return label (UPS, FedEx).
    • Does not include mailing transit time.
